13-Year-Old Girl Walking Dog Struck By Vehicle In West Oak Lane, Philadelphia Police Say

PHILADELPHIA (CBS) -- A 13-year-old girl walking her dog was struck by a vehicle in West Oak Lane Wednesday night, police say. It happened at the intersection of 66th Avenue and North Smedley Street around 6:30 p.m.

Police say a driver in a black Mazda SUV struck the teen while she was crossing the street with her dog.

The girl is currently in critical condition at St. Christopher's Hospital for Children.
